Hanoi Museum (Nam Tu Liem District, Hanoi) is one of the major projects built to celebrate the 1,000th anniversary of Thang Long - Hanoi, inaugurated in 2010. This is a place to preserve many valuable documents and images of the thousand-year-old capital. The beautiful and unique inverted pyramid design of Hanoi Museum was once rated by Business magazine as one of the museums with the most beautiful architecture in the world .

Inside, the walkway with its prominent spiral staircase architecture, combined with the lighting system, is likened by visitors to a "path of light" when they come here to visit.

The museum currently preserves more than 70,000 documents and artifacts made from various materials, which are historical evidence of thousands of years of Thang Long - Hanoi.

According to the leader of Hanoi Museum, the number of visitors to the museum since the Covid-19 epidemic is much higher than before, on average there will be about 700 - 800 visitors on weekdays, on weekends or during events the number of visitors can reach 4,000 - 6,000 people/day.

A separate corner recreates the culture and life of the ancient Hanoians with many artifacts. Notably, artifacts related to the living space of wealthy families in Hanoi more than 100 years ago are also on display. To connect and attract visitors to the museum, in addition to organizing exhibition topics in the usual way, the Hanoi Museum regularly organizes talks right at the topics and has activities for visitors to experience directly, to live in the cultural space, the old traditions.
